Not only did LSU lose out on its chance at a national title, but the team may have lost its star running back, at least for a little while.

A source close to the team told WDSU sports anchor Keli Fulton that starting running back Charles Scott has a broken collarbone.

WDSU NBC (New Orleans): LSU Back Has Broken Collarbone

No real shock here given the way that it looked on the field, but nevertheless you hate to hear this one for Scott. He's had a rough year due to little fault of his own, but he played a fine game yesterday and gave us a lot of problems. You hate to say it, but given the nature of his injury his collegiate career is probably over. At least with his talent he'll play at the next level and get paid lots of money to do so, so best wishes to him.
